Managing the User Login Process
Implementing Strong Passwords
Strong Passwords can be implemented for logging into the Collaboration Server management applications.
They can be implemented when the system is in standard security mode or when in Ultra Secure Mode.
The FORCE_STRONG_PASSWORD_POLICY System Flag, which enables or disables all password
related flags cannot be set to NO and all Strong Passwords rules are automatically enabled and cannot be
disabled when the ULTRA_SECURE_MODE System Flag is set to YES.
If an administrator modifies any of the Strong Passwords flag settings, all users are forced to perform the
password change procedure, ensuring that all user passwords conform to the modified Strong Passwords
settings.
Administrators can change passwords for users and other administrators. When changing passwords for
him/herself, other administrators or other users, the administrator is required to enter his/her own
administrator’s password.
Strong Passwords rules are enforced according to the settings of the various Strong Passwords flags as
described in System Flags affected by Ultra Secure Mode. Default settings of these flag change according
to the system security mode.
Password Character Composition
When the FORCE_STRONG_PASSWORD_POLICY System Flag is set to YES:
A Strong Password must contain at least one of all of the following character types:
Upper case letters
Lower case letters
Numbers
Special characters: @ # $ % ^ & * ( ) _ - = + | } { : " \ ] [ ; / ? > < , . (space) ~
When the FORCE_STRONG_PASSWORD_POLICY and ULTRA_SECURE_MODE System Flags
are set to YES:
A Strong Password must contain at least two of all of the following character types:
Upper case letters
Lower case letters
Numbers
Special characters: @ # $ % ^ & * ( ) _ - = + | } { : " \ ] [ ; / ? > < , . (space) ~
Passwords cannot contain the User ID (User Name) in any form. Example: A user with a User ID,
ben, is not permitted to use “123BeN321” as a password because BeN is similar to the User ID.
Passwords cannot contain more than four digits in succession.
When the strong password option is enabled and the password does not meet the Strong Password
requirements the error Password characteristics do not comply with Enhance Security
requirements is displayed.
